About Hexeal

Hexeal is a fast-growing FMCG e-commerce business shipping approximately 25,000 orders per week across the UK. We are looking for an organised, driven and hands-on Assistant Warehouse & Production Manager to support the Warehouse & Production Manager in leading our warehouse and production operations. This is a varied role combining leadership, operational management, quality control and continuous improvement. The successful candidate will play a key role in ensuring our warehouse and production departments operate safely, efficiently and to the highest standards.

Key Responsibilities

  • Operational Management
    • Support the day-to-day management of warehouse and production operations.
    • Help ensure the smooth processing and fulfilment of approximately 25,000 customer orders per week.
    • Monitor productivity, workflow and operational performance.
    • Identify opportunities to improve efficiency and reduce waste.
  • Team Leadership
    • Assist in managing and developing warehouse and production teams.
    • Support recruitment, onboarding and training of new staff.
    • Allocate work and monitor team performance.
    • Foster a positive and accountable working culture.
  • Health & Safety
    • Ensure compliance with company Health & Safety policies and procedures.
    • Conduct routine inspections and safety checks.
    • Assist with risk assessments and incident investigations.
    • Promote a strong safety-first culture throughout the operation.
  • Quality Control
    • Maintain high product quality standards across production and fulfilment processes.
    • Investigate quality issues and implement corrective actions.
    • Support contin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Stock Control
    • Oversee stock accuracy and inventory management.
    • Coordinate stocktakes and cycle counting activities.
    • Investigate discrepancies and implement preventative measures.
  • Goods In & Goods Out
    • Manage the efficient receipt, checking and storage of incoming goods.
    • Ensure accurate picking, packing and dispatch of customer orders.
    • Maintain warehouse organisation and stock rotation standards.
  • Equipment & Maintenance
    • Coordinate routine maintenance schedules for production and warehouse equipment.
    • Monitor machinery performance and arrange repairs where required.
    • Minimise operational downtime through proactive maintenance planning.
  • Administration & Reporting
    • Maintain accurate warehouse and production records.
    • Produce operational reports and KPI data.
    • Support planning and scheduling activities.
